| With the growth of China’s economic level,China’s urbanization process is gradually accelerating,followed by the improvement of the rural economic level,the living conditions of rural residents have gradually improved,and the requirements for the living environment have also increased.In addition,China is vigorously advancing the construction of the Guangdong-Hong Kong-Macao Greater Bay Area in the Guangdong-Hong Kong-Macao region.Against this background,the Zhuhai Municipal Government is currently committed to building a new special zone of ecological civilization,and the construction of rural areas in Zhuhai has also become an important part of its development.To sum up,this article takes Zhuhai area’s rural houses as the research object,and discusses the design strategies of assembled low-energy rural houses that are suitable for Zhuhai area and can allow rural residents to participate in the design.The main research contents are as follows:First of all,a survey of local rural villages in Zhuhai was conducted,and a thorough and detailed investigation was conducted on the evolutionary context,basic profile,current status of energy-saving design,energy consumption characteristics,layout forms,and household structure and lifestyle of the local rural houses,and selected Energy consumption simulation of a typical residential form to understand its energy consumption status.So as to determine the direction for the subsequent low energy consumption design,and provide a basis for the design of prefabricated rural houses.Secondly,based on the results of field investigations,research on low energy consumption design strategies for local rural houses.Based on the analysis of the climate characteristics of Zhuhai,the passive energy-saving strategy is systematically studied from three aspects: shading design,natural ventilation design,and building insulation and moisture-proof design.Active energy-saving strategies mainly focus on the use of solar energy.These low energy consumption strategies are systematically summarized,and application methods and reference forms of various design strategies are proposed,so that residents can choose corresponding low energy consumption measures based on the actual conditions of their respective houses.Third,based on the investigation and analysis of rural functional space requirements and family structure in Zhuhai,the research on assembly modularization of rural houses in Zhuhai was conducted.Based on various factors,the light steel structure was selected as the structural system of the prefabricated rural house,and a set of prefabricated module libraries including wall modules,standardized doors and windows,standardized modules for various functional spaces,and standardized additional modules such as balconies and sunshade members were established;Then based on the concept of low energy consumption,based on the module library,several standardized combined planes suitable for rural Zhuhai were proposed,and the analysis of the flexibility and variability of the assembled planes was made to allow residents to design a low energy consumption strategy based on their own needs.Own House.Finally,through the program design of low-energy prefabricated rural houses in Zhuhai,the results of the research on the low-energy and prefabricated design strategies of rural houses in this paper are simulated and displayed,and computer software is used to simulate and verify energy consumption Its energy saving effect. |
